Next Opponent For AJ Styles
AJ Styles’ title reign has been a phenomenal one so far. It’s likely that his feud with Dean Ambrose is over for now. So, who’s next in line to challenge him? For Tuesday, a championship match has been announced between him and James Ellsworth. This is due to Ellsworth earning that opportunity when he won the Smackdown contract. Furthermore, reports say Styles got injured at the TLC PPV.

Alexa Bliss-Becky Lynch Feud Far From Over
It was good to see Alexa Bliss winning Smackdown women’s title at TLC. However, Becky Lynch is totally upset and furious with her own performance. This rivalry is far from over and will continue with an even fired up Becky Lynch who will try to get back what was her. A rematch will surely take place soon.
